Skrapa

En nybörjarguide för webbskrapning med Python och vacker soppa

En nybörjarguide för webbskrapning med Python och vacker soppa
  1. Hur skrapar du en webbplats med Python och BeautifulSoup?
  2. Hur lär jag mig webbskrapning i Python?
  3. Hur skrapar du data med hjälp av BeautifulSoup?
  4. Vad är det bästa sättet att lära sig webbskrapning?
  5. Varför Python används för webbskrapning?
  6. Är webbskrapning lagligt?
  7. Hur lång tid tar det att lära sig webbskrapning?
  8. Är BeautifulSoup snabbare än selen?
  9. Hur lång tid tar det att lära sig webbskrapning?
  10. Skrapar Amazon lagligt?
  11. Hur skrapar jag på Amazon med BeautifulSoup?
  12. Vad är det bästa webbskrapningsverktyget?

Hur skrapar du en webbplats med Python och BeautifulSoup?

Först måste vi importera alla bibliotek som vi ska använda. Därefter deklarerar du en variabel för sidans webbadress. Använd sedan Python urllib2 för att få URL-sidan deklarerad. Slutligen analysera sidan i BeautifulSoup-format så att vi kan använda BeautifulSoup för att arbeta med den.

Hur lär jag mig webbskrapning i Python?

För att extrahera data med webbskrapning med python måste du följa dessa grundläggande steg:

  1. Hitta den URL som du vill skrapa.
  2. Inspektera sidan.
  3. Hitta de data du vill extrahera.
  4. Skriv koden.
  5. Kör koden och extrahera data.
  6. Lagra data i önskat format.

Hur skrapar du data med hjälp av BeautifulSoup?

Steg för att skrapa vilken webbplats som helst

Skicka en HTTP GET-begäran till webbadressen till den webbsida som du vill skrapa, som kommer att svara med HTML-innehåll. Vi kan göra detta genom att använda begäran-biblioteket för Python. Hämta och analysera data med hjälp av Beautifulsoup och underhålla data i någon datastruktur som Dict eller List.

Vad är det bästa sättet att lära sig webbskrapning?

5 bästa webbskrotningskurser att lära sig 2021

  1. Webbskrapning i Nodejs & JavaScript. Denna kurs erbjuds på Udemy. ...
  2. Utforska webbskrapning med Python. Detta är en utmärkt kurs för att lära dig webbskrotning i Pluralsight. ...
  3. Webbskrapning i Python. ...
  4. Lär dig webbskrapning med vacker soppa. ...
  5. Använda Python för att komma åt webbdata.

Varför Python används för webbskrapning?

Anledningen till att Python är ett föredraget språk att använda för webbskrapning är att Scrapy and Beautiful Soup är två av de mest använda ramarna baserade på Python. Vacker soppa, det är ett Python-bibliotek som är utformat för snabb och mycket effektiv dataextraktion.

Är webbskrapning lagligt?

Så är det lagligt eller olagligt? Webbskrapning och genomsökning är inte olagligt i sig. När allt kommer omkring kan du skrapa eller genomsöka din egen webbplats utan problem. ... Stora företag använder webbskrapor för egen vinning men vill inte heller att andra ska använda robotar mot dem.

Hur lång tid tar det att lära sig webbskrapning?

När jag lärde mig python, håller min första skrapa som laddar ner alla bilder från en viss webbplats, historik över saker som den laddade ner så att den kan återupptas även om den kraschar och etc tog mig två dagar. Nu eftersom de är nybörjare, låt oss säga att de tar ungefär tio dagar.

Är BeautifulSoup snabbare än selen?

Webbskrapor som använder antingen Scrapy eller BeautifulSoup använder sig av Selenium om de behöver data som bara kan vara tillgängliga när Javascript-filer laddas. Selen är snabbare än BeautifulSoup men lite långsammare än Scrapy.

Hur lång tid tar det att lära sig webbskrapning?

Det tar en vecka att lära sig grunderna i teknik för webbutveckling. En vecka för att lära sig webbskrapning och pythonbibliotek som NumPy, pandor, matplotlib för datahantering och analys.

Skrapar Amazon lagligt?

Det är lagligt att skrapa Amazonas webbplats för de uppgifter som är tillgängliga för folket. De uppgifter som Amazon har gjort privata och blockerat alla sökrobotar, att skrapa dem är inte lagligt och kan vara föremål för juridiska problem och Amazon kan till och med stämma den person eller sökrobot som försöker genomsöka dessa specifika uppgifter.

Hur skrapar jag på Amazon med BeautifulSoup?

Skrapa Amazonas bästsäljande böcker

  1. Definiera en get_data-funktion som matar in sidnumren som ett argument,
  2. Definiera en användaragent som hjälper till att kringgå detekteringen som en skrapa,
  3. Ange URL till förfrågningar. ...
  4. Extrahera innehållet från förfrågningar. ...
  5. Skrapa den angivna sidan och tilldela den till soppvariabel,

Vad är det bästa webbskrapningsverktyget?

Topp 8 verktyg för webbskrapning

Så här installerar du Apache 2.4
Öppna en kommandotolk Kör som administratör. Navigera till katalog c / Apache24 / bin. Lägg till Apache som en Windows-tjänst httpd.exe -k installera ...
Så här skyddar du specifik URL i Apache
Så här skyddar du specifik URL i Apache-inställning IP-baserad begränsning av specifik URL. Redigera först konfigurationsfilen för apache och lägg til...
Så här installerar du senaste Apache Ant på Ubuntu, Debian och Linux Mint
Hur installerar jag Apache på Linux Mint? Hur uppdaterar jag min myra?? Vad är Ant på Ubuntu? Hur installerar jag Apache NetBeans Ubuntu? Hur startar ...